> Region: Conceiçāo do Rio Verde, Mantiqueira de Minas, Minas Gerais Elevation: 930-1050 masl About: To call Fazenda Santa Clara a family business doesn’t quite capture the Pereira family’s dedication to their farm—it’s a family passion. Established in the early 1900s by Italian and Portuguese immigrants, Santa Clara has been passed down through generations of the Pereira family. At the beginning of what we now know as specialty coffee, Fazenda Santa Clara was run by Moacyr Dias Pereira and his wife, Alayde Graciano Pereira. Since Moacyr’s passing and Alayde’s retirement, the farm is now shepherded by their four children: Fernando, Carlos Henrique, Eduardo, and Luciana—the fourth generation of the Pereira family to dedicate their lives to working the land. Through generations of hard work, the Pereira family knows that consistent and sustainable agriculture starts with taking care of the land. Without biodiversity, a farm simply cannot survive, and out of respect for their father’s hard work and legacy, Moacyr’s children approach environmental preservation with the same passion as producing high-quality coffee. Large sections of the farm are reserved to protect native forests and natural water sources.
